Bridging the Gap: Equitable Access to STEM Education

Providing equitable opportunity to STEM education is paramount for fostering a diverse and inclusive future workforce. Countless barriers prevent students from underrepresented groups from fully engaging in science, technology, engineering, and mathematics. These barriers can include absence of resources, limited exposure to STEM role models, and reinforcing societal biases. To overcome this gap, we must implement comprehensive solutions that resolve these systemic challenges. This requires a multi-faceted approach that consists of initiatives such as providing equitable funding to underserved schools, fostering mentorship programs connecting students with STEM professionals from diverse backgrounds, and cultivating a culture that values the contributions of all individuals in STEM.

By dedicating in equitable access to STEM education, we can unlock the full potential of every student and create a future where innovation and progress are driven by a diverse range of voices.

Hands-On Learning: Engaging Students in STEM Inquiry

In today's dynamic educational landscape, traditional teaching methods are being challenged by innovative approaches that prioritize student engagement and active learning. Specifically, hands-on learning has emerged as a powerful tool for fostering deep understanding in STEM fields. Through interactive experiments, real-world problem-solving activities, and collaborative projects, students can transform their theoretical knowledge into practical skills.

Hands-on learning not only promotes critical thinking and creativity but also strengthens essential STEM literacy. When students immersively participate in the learning process, they develop a more profound appreciation for the interconnectedness of scientific concepts and their real-world applications.
